Web26 jul. 2024 · How to Pour Latte Art Now, onto pouring. Tilt the cup at a 45 degree angle. Begin pouring with the pitcher high above the cup, about 4 inches. Start pouring slowly, directly into the center of the deepest part, then move around the cup to mix in the crema and set a blank canvas. Web25 dec. 2024 · The Coffee Flower. (1) Pour the velvety milk foam in a thin stream under the crema until the cup is almost full. (2) Use a spoon to draw a thick milk ring around the edge of the cup. (3) Put a dollop of milk foam in the middle of the cup. (4) Using a wooden stick, draw a line from the milk circle to the edge of the cup. Web17 aug. 2024 · Step 2: The latte art heart. Now it’s time for the art. Web27 jan. 2024 · Generally speaking, latte art doesn’t require really hot milk, as going too high will cause your foam to disintegrate. For dairy milk, you generally should steam until 140 to 150°F. Beyond that, the milk will become too firm and aerated. Higher than 160°F, and the milk will burn or curdle. ford 99 f150 short bed covers
